What is GFRP ?

GFRP stands for Glass Fiber Reinforced Polymer (or Plastic). It is a composite material made of glass fibers embedded in a polymer matrix (usually epoxy, polyester, or vinyl ester). GFRP combines the strength of glass fibers with the lightweight and corrosion-resistant properties of polymers.

Table of Substitution

GFRP REBARS METAL REBARS
Dia Weight (12m) Dia Weight (12m)
3.0 mm0.185 Kg----
3.5 mm0.280 Kg----
4.5 mm0.468 Kg6 mm2.75 Kg
6.0 mm0.570 Kg8 mm4.74 Kg
7.0 mm0.940 Kg10 mm7.40 Kg
8.0 mm1.200 Kg12 mm10.65 Kg
10.0 mm1.600 Kg14 mm14.52 Kg
12.0 mm2.400 Kg16 mm18.93 Kg
14.0 mm3.240 Kg18 mm24.00 Kg
16.0 mm4.870 Kg22 mm35.76 Kg
18.0 mm6.280 Kg25 mm46.22 Kg
20.0 mm8.080 Kg28 mm58.02 Kg
22.0 mm9.800 Kg32 mm75.79 Kg
25.0 mm11.670 Kg40 mm118.52 Kg

Standards & Design Guides of GFRP Rebars in India

  • IS 18255: 2023
    Fibre-Reinforced Polymer (FRP) Rebars for Concrete Reinforcement – Methods of Test.

  • IS 18256: 2023
    Solid round glass fibre reinforced polymer (GFRP) Rebars for Concrete Reinforcement Specification.

  • IRC: 137 – 2022
    Guidelines on use of fibre-reinforced polymer bars in road projects.
